#63d703 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#63d703 is composed of 38.8% red, 84.3%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.6%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 92.8 degrees, a saturation of 97.2% and a lightness of 42.7%. #63d703 color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ff06 with #00af00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

#63d703 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#63d703 has RGB values of R:99, G:215,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0, Y:0.99,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 6543107.
